💬What is Amgel Easy Room Escape 81?
Amgel Easy Room Escape 81 drops you into a small, tidy room that's far less innocent than it looks. You click around—drawers, shelves, the edge of a rug—and every object might hide a clue or a tool. The first time I played, I spent five minutes staring at a painting that was actually a puzzle in disguise. That's the charm: the game doesn't yell at you, it just waits. You'll need to combine items, remember numbers, and sometimes click a specific order of things. The 'Easy' in the title is a lie—it's easy if you're methodical, but one overlooked corner can trap you for ten minutes.
Mouse control is the whole deal. No keyboard shortcuts, no time limit, just you and the room. The interface is basic but clean, and every interaction gives a little visual feedback, so you know when you're onto something. I kept a mental checklist of spots I hadn't fully explored, and that saved me more than once. The puzzles are logical, not random: a four-digit code might be hidden in a book's page numbers, a key might be taped under a chair. There's no jump scare, no death, just the satisfying click of a lock opening.
If you're into escape rooms but don't want to install anything, this is a solid bite-sized brain teaser. It's part of a long series, so the formula is polished. My only gripe: some pixel-hunting is required, especially for small keys or buttons. But that's also what makes the final door swing open feel earned. Play it during a break—you won't need more than fifteen minutes, but you might stay longer just to prove you can do it without hints.

✨Game Tips
Click everything—even the empty corners; some triggers are invisible until you hover.
Write down any numbers you see, especially on books or frames, they're usually part of a code.
Combine items in your inventory even if they don't seem related, the game rewards experimentation.
Stuck on a lock? Stop trying combos and scan the room for the matching colors or shapes instead.
The game doesn't punish clicks, so spam cautiously but pay attention to cursor changes.
🔧FAQ
Q: Is Amgel Easy Room Escape 81 free to play?
A: Yes, it runs right in your browser with no payment or subscription required.
Q: Can I play Amgel Easy Room Escape 81 on my phone?
A: Yes, it works on mobile browsers, though a mouse makes clicking tiny objects easier.
Q: Do I need to download or install anything?
A: No, it's an HTML5 game that loads instantly on any modern browser.
Q: How long does a typical playthrough take?
A: Most players finish in 10-20 minutes, depending on how many hints they miss.
Q: Does the game save my progress if I close the tab?
A: No, there's no save system; you'll restart from the beginning each session.
Q: Is Amgel Easy Room Escape 81 suitable for younger players?
A: Yes, it's non-violent and logic-based, perfect for ages 10 and up.
